I was on eforex-trading a few days ago and they recommend a managed account from Tridence Capital (tridencecapital.com), known as the Tridence MMA .

I was wondering if anyone knows anything about this site or if anyone has experiences with them?

A few things I have found out: the president, Walter De Milly, is the guy behind Piptronix, which wasn't very successful. That leaves me a bit wary of his latest venture, although the Tridence managed accounts use human fund managers rather than the EA as was the case with Piptronix.

Another thing which struck me as strange (credit to Pharaoh's thread on not losing money with Forex for pointing this out) was the fact that they have returns data going back to the beginning of 2009 yet their domain was only registered in June 2012 (last month).

I like a lot of things on their site e.g. risk management strategy, of course their returns etc., but they're so new I have no idea about knowing if they are legit or not.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
